Idiom Meaning Explained: "As Cool As A Cucumber"

The phrase "As cool as a cucumber" is an idiom used to describe someone who is very calm and relaxed, especially in a situation that would normally make people anxious or upset.

Understanding the Idiom

Cucumbers are known for their cool temperature, even on a hot day. This natural characteristic is used metaphorically to represent a person's ability to remain composed and unemotional, maintaining a level head under pressure.

Analyzing the Options

  • 1. Be cold hearted: This means lacking sympathy or emotion. While the idiom involves being calm, it doesn't imply being unemotional or uncaring.
  • 2. Calm: This meaning perfectly captures the essence of the idiom. Someone who is "as cool as a cucumber" is indeed calm and not easily flustered.
  • 3. Be careless: This suggests a lack of attention or concern. Being calm and composed is different from being careless.
  • 4. Lacking composure: This is the opposite of the idiom's meaning. The idiom describes someone who has excellent composure.

Conclusion

Based on the analysis, the most fitting meaning for the idiom "As cool as a cucumber" is being Calm.
